Small details change the meaning: what you cooked, whether it worked, and who the food was for.
A meal that comes together suggests preparation, emotional digestion and the ability to make something usable from many ingredients.
Burned food points to too much pressure, neglected timing or a process that has been overheated by urgency.
Cooking for others asks how much care you are giving, and whether that care is nourishing you as well.
An unfamiliar kitchen often shows the backstage of a new role, relationship or project where you have not yet learned the tools.
Cooking is a precise dream image because it is both practical and symbolic. It turns separate raw materials into something that can be taken in. In a dream, those ingredients may be feelings, tasks, memories, hopes, duties, appetites or relationship dynamics.
The central question is not only what you cooked, but how the process felt. Calm cooking suggests integration. Rushed cooking points to pressure. Burned food shows heat without enough attention. Cooking for others brings up care, responsibility and the wish to be useful.

A cooking dream is not reduced to good luck or bad luck. It is read through preparation, timing, heat, appetite and who receives the result.
Cooking meat, bread, soup, sweets or vegetables can point to different kinds of nourishment. The dream asks what kind of energy is being transformed.
Cooking alone, cooking for family and cooking for strangers each carry a different message about responsibility, visibility and care.
Cooking for others can be loving, but it can also be exhausting. The dream may ask whether you are giving from abundance or from obligation. If no one eats the food, the issue may be recognition. If too many people are waiting, the issue may be demand.
This version often appears when someone is carrying invisible emotional labor: keeping a household, team, relationship or family system functioning. The food becomes a symbol of what you provide.
When food burns, the dream usually points to timing and attention. Something may have been left on the fire too long. Another possibility is that you are trying to force a process that needs slower heat.
Food that never cooks can show a project, feeling or relationship that has ingredients but not enough energy, structure or commitment to become nourishing.
Many cooking dreams appear when an experience is not raw anymore, but also not fully integrated. You may have enough distance to work with it, season it, understand it, and decide how much of it belongs in your life now.
This is why cooking dreams often come during transitions: a new job, a changing relationship, a move, a family responsibility, or a creative project that needs a more embodied rhythm. The dream shows the process of turning experience into something you can live from.

Seasoning shows adjustment. The dream may ask what small change would make a situation more alive, more honest or more suited to you.
Cutting ingredients suggests analysis and preparation. You may be breaking a large issue into workable pieces.
Stirring points to combination. Different feelings, people or tasks are influencing each other and need steady attention.

An unfamiliar kitchen can mean you are trying to care, create or perform inside a system whose rules you do not fully know yet. The tools may be different, the timing may feel strange, and even simple actions can take more attention than usual.
This version is common when a person enters a new role. You may know how to cook in your old environment, but the dream shows that this new kitchen asks for new habits, new timing and a different way of trusting your hands.
